Prayer For the City
Prayer for the City Dear God, How heavy are my thoughts tonight! I feel the ills of the city, pressing, pressing. For all the young people being arrested, right now. Lord, hear my prayer. For a hand lifting in anger toward another For the body that prostitutes to feed the need For all those in captivity of any kind Lord, hear my prayers. For the protecting of a child in danger For the sacred souls in all children Lord, hear my prayers For those who sit under bridges, doorways and plastic bags Lord, hear my prayer For every siren wail and 911 call For every doctor waging war with a bullet or knife hole Lord, hear my prayers For every noisy, cramped, dysfunctional, roach infested house where a flower blooms, Lord, hear my prayer. 2/5/17 social justice free verse Sponsored by: John Hamilton
